Cash Flow Ratios
Spencer Company reports the following amounts in its annual financial statements:

Cash flow from operating activities $90,000   Capital expenditures $59,500*
Cash flow from investing activities (68,000)   Average current assets 136,000
Cash flow from financing activities (8,500)   Average current liabilities 102,000
Net income 42,500   Total assets 255,000

* This amount is a cash outflow

a. Compute Spencer's free cash flow.
b. Compute Spencer's operating-cash-flow-to-current-liabilities ratio.
c. Compute Spencer's operating-cash-flow-to-capital-expenditures ratio.

Round ratios to two decimal points.
